Motor car manufacturers are using increasing quantities of all types of plastics; 1956 model passenger cars, sports cars, and trucks indicate that reinforced plastics are moving rapidly into regular production components; use of vinyl, acrylics, nylon, metallized mylar, butyrate, etc. (See also - n 7 Mar 1956 p 89-94, 211-2, 218-20)
